5 gallons is much too small for a sorority. 5 gallons is too small for any tank mates other than snails for a betta. Sororities need lots of space ( I recommend 40 gallon minimum), and hiding places to work, and advanced knowledge of Betta behavior. Honestly, sororities are not worth the extra stress and disease that they come with.

This was most likely caused by fighting and stress. Keep them separate and treat the sick betta in a shallow tank while they have trouble swimming. Tannins and salt will help with any injuries and with the possible swim bladder disease. Watch for any secondary infections. You will need to get harder meds if they get worse. Treat both bettas with the salt and tannins because they both probably have injuries.

Good advice; another possible trigger for the illness, since OP asked what could be the cause, is adding new livestock without quarantine and introducing a new disease which wasn’t previously present, or even, if the tank cycle is new or delicate for some reason it could cause a spike of ammonia.
